Two more book recommendations! "Glued to games" by Scott Rigby and Richard M. Ryan made a huge splash in the video games industry over the last ten years. IWhile it is about video games, it talks about motivation to play in games, which is applicable to board games as well. And then there is "On Writing - a memoir of the craft" by Stephen King. This book is about writing, but it it such a precise description of creative work and creative being, that I see it as the best book on game design I ever read. Because a lot of the talking points can be transferred, when doing the transfer from books, reading and writing to games, gameplay and designing. I highly recommend that one.
